Abstract

In this paper, firstly we discuss the architecture of a flexible automated production system under which all components are well-modulized. Then, a solution, EMFAK (Event-driven Multi-tasking Flexible Automation Kernel) is proposed to speed up the construction of system control. At last, a flexible assembly system using EMFAK is described to show how to apply it to a real flexible automated production system.
